Sans Normal Bonup 7 is a regular weight, normal width, low contrast, upright, tall x-height font visually similar to 'FF Cocon' by FontFont (names referenced only for comparison).

A rounded, monoline sans with soft terminals and gently squared curves that keep forms smooth and even. Proportions feel contemporary, with a notably tall x-height and open apertures that support clarity in text. Bowls and counters are generous and mostly circular/elliptical, while joins stay simple and consistent. Overall spacing reads comfortable and slightly roomy, giving lines an easy rhythm.
Well-suited to interface copy and general-purpose text where a clear, approachable voice is needed. It can also work for contemporary branding, packaging, and signage, and scales comfortably into short headline use thanks to its simple, rounded forms.
The font projects a friendly, modern tone—clean and pragmatic without feeling sterile. Its rounded shapes and soft endings add approachability, making it feel conversational and user-centered.
Likely designed as an everyday sans that balances neutrality with warmth: high legibility at small sizes, smooth shapes for screen-friendly rendering, and a personable tone for modern products and communications.
Curves are consistently softened (including in diagonals and bowls), which reduces sharpness in letters and numerals. The overall construction stays straightforward and legible, with a mild humanist warmth rather than a strictly geometric rigidity.
